COMPANY ANNOUNCEMENT

Malta International Airport plc (the "Company")

Traffic Results – February 2014

Reference: 172/2014

In Terms of Chapter 5 of the Listing Rules

Malta International Airport this year registered the best ever figures for February when it welcomed a total of 193,225 passengers. This figure is an increase of 9.3% from last year, breaking all previous records for such period

February's figures were due to an added capacity of 7% and a consistent seat load factor, which went up by 1.5 percentage points to reach overall 72.5% for the month.

Traffic from the UK grew consistently by 7.6 per cent, mirroring previous month's results. Italy once again remains the second biggest market registering the highest growth, for the month, of 17.4% proving the popularity of the Northern routes.

"The increased traffic during the winter months shows that our efforts in promoting Malta as year-round destination are bearing fruit. We are pleased to have hosted a total of 392,579 passengers between January and February showing a consistent positive trend during this time of year," said Malta International Airport CEO Markus Klaushofer.

Meanwhile, aircraft movements for the month increased by 7.8 per cent. This was reflected in the increase of 7 per cent in seat capacity which reached 266,678, when compared to the corresponding period of the previous year.

Seat Load Factor registered an increase of 1.5 percentage points, while the maximum take-off weight (MTOW) increased by 6.9 per cent when compared to 2013 figures.

Cargo and mail registered a decline of 5.3 per cent over the previous year.

Overview st
– 28th February 2014
1
% Change*
Passenger Movements 193,225 9.3%
Aircraft Movements 1,638 7.7%
Cargo and Mail (in tonnes) 1,186 -5.3%
Seat Capacity 266,678 7.0%
Seat Load Factor 72.5% 1.5 PPD
MTOW (in tonnes) 143,856 6.9%
